How to silence the DSC home alarm keypads?
How to Silence the Beeping Keypads 1 Go to any keypad and make sure the system is disarmed. If not, enter your disarm code as usual. 2 Press the “ 3 ” key. This will silence your DSC alarm system keypads. More …

What does number 1 mean on a DSc alarm?
Number 1 corresponds to Service Required, though you may just do it yourself depending on the specific trouble. To know the specific trouble, press number 1. If it displays “Low Battery” and you had a recent power outage, wait 24 hours after the power comes back on. The battery just needs to recharge first.

How do you set the time on a DSc alarm?
In any case, you can easily set the time and date by pressing the following in order: star (*) key, number 6, Main Code, and number 1. Type in the correct time in the military format. Then, enter the current date in the MM/DD/YY format. To exit, press the pound (#) key and you’re set.

How can I tell if my DSC power series is in trouble?
Press the number corresponding to the trouble condition to view the additional information. To view a trouble condition, press [*] [2]. The trouble light will flash and the LCD will display the first trouble condition present. Use the arrow keys to scroll through all trouble conditions present.
